What is the least amount of syrup pumps a (Short) Latte receives?

A Short Latte, which is typically a 8-ounce beverage, generally receives 2 pumps of syrup as a standard. This is consistent across many flavored espresso beverages to maintain a balanced flavor profile, ensuring that the sweetness from the syrup complements the coffee rather than overwhelming it.

The amount of syrup is standardized to ensure consistency in taste and quality across all Starbucks locations. Even for smaller beverages like the Short Latte, starting with 2 pumps provides a framework for the flavor ratios that baristas adhere to, making it easier to order and customize beverages while maintaining the essence of the drink.

This standardization supports the overall customer experience, ensuring that regardless of when or where someone orders a Short Latte, they receive a beverage that matches their expectations in flavor and sweetness.
